Transaction 6f2f87d1200227f48396b35cfd60c1cc612294914113d11eae8bbd06748423b1

block
54a2a14351fef953cb5c15fdaa9712d7fc1ef5ef6a9f801438ea9f765fa0f6ba

1 Input

23 Outputs